Horsepower, Voltage, and Current Ratings

Horsepower (HP) indicates the motor’s mechanical output power, essential for determining its suitability for specific applications. Voltage ratings specify the motor’s designed operating voltage, crucial for compatibility with power supplies. Current ratings, often listed as full-load amps (FLA), indicate the expected current draw under normal operation. These ratings are vital for selecting appropriate wiring, circuit breakers, and motor control devices. Proper matching of voltage and current ensures efficient operation and prevents overheating or premature wear. Understanding these ratings helps in sizing the motor correctly for the load, ensuring optimal performance and safety. Always refer to the nameplate for these values to avoid mismatches and potential system failures.

Insulation Class and Temperature Rise

The insulation class on a motor nameplate indicates the material’s ability to withstand heat, ensuring reliable operation within specified temperature limits. Common classes include A, B, F, and H, with higher classes tolerating greater heat. Temperature rise, measured in degrees Celsius, reflects the increase in motor temperature above ambient levels during operation. This specification is critical for determining the motor’s suitability for high-temperature environments and ensuring longevity. Exceeding the rated temperature can lead to insulation degradation, reducing motor lifespan and efficiency. Proper understanding of these ratings helps in selecting motors for demanding applications and maintaining optimal performance under various operating conditions. Adhering to these limits is essential for safe and efficient motor operation, as specified by standards like NEMA or IEC.

Service Factor and Duty Cycle

The service factor (SF) indicates the maximum overload a motor can handle without damaging. Typically, motors have a service factor of 1.0 or 1.15, meaning they can operate at 100% or 115% of their rated horsepower. Duty cycle refers to the motor’s operating pattern, such as continuous, intermittent, or periodic operation. Understanding these ratings ensures the motor is used within its design limits, preventing overheating or premature wear. For example, a motor with a 1.15 SF should not exceed 115% of its rated load for extended periods. Duty cycles are crucial for applications with varying workloads, as they determine how often the motor can start, run, and rest. Properly matching the motor’s service factor and duty cycle to the application ensures safe, efficient, and reliable operation. These specifications are vital for industrial and commercial motor installations. Always consult the nameplate for accurate ratings.

Common Symbols and Abbreviations Used

Motor nameplates use standardized symbols and abbreviations to convey essential information. Common terms include HP for horsepower, V for voltage, and RPM for revolutions per minute. Efficiency classes like IE1, IE2, and IE3 indicate energy efficiency levels. NEMA and IEC denote frame size standards, while PH specifies the number of phases (e.g., 3PH or 1PH). Insulation classes are marked as A, B, F, or H, representing temperature tolerance. Hz stands for frequency, and PF denotes power factor. These symbols ensure consistency and clarity, allowing technicians to quickly identify motor specifications. Understanding these abbreviations is crucial for proper installation, operation, and maintenance of electric motors. Always refer to manufacturer guidelines for specific interpretations, as variations may exist. This standardized approach ensures safe and efficient motor operation across applications.

What Are OBD-II Codes and Their Structure

OBD-II codes are standardized diagnostic trouble codes used to identify vehicle issues. Each code consists of a five-character alphanumeric structure‚ starting with a letter (P‚ C‚ B‚ U) indicating the system affected. The subsequent digits specify the fault type and location. For example‚ P0171 refers to a system too lean in Bank 1. These codes are essential for quick diagnosis and repairs‚ especially when referenced from a Dodge Ram 1500 codes list PDF‚ ensuring accurate troubleshooting and maintenance.

P0300 ⎼ Random Cylinder Misfire Detected

The P0300 code indicates a random cylinder misfire in the engine. This occurs when the powertrain control module detects an inconsistent or erratic firing pattern across multiple cylinders. Common causes include faulty spark plugs‚ ignition coils‚ or fuel injectors. A vacuum leak‚ low fuel pressure‚ or worn-out piston rings may also trigger this code. Symptoms often include a rough engine idle‚ decreased power‚ and a noticeable decrease in fuel efficiency. Addressing this issue promptly is crucial to prevent potential damage to the catalytic converter or other engine components. Referencing a detailed codes list PDF can provide specific troubleshooting steps for accurate diagnosis and repair.

P0171 ⎼ System Too Lean (Bank 1)

The P0171 code signifies that the engine’s air-fuel mixture in Bank 1 is too lean‚ meaning there’s an excessive amount of air relative to fuel. This can result from a vacuum leak‚ faulty mass airflow sensor‚ or oxygen sensor malfunction. It may also stem from clogged fuel injectors or a failing fuel pressure regulator. Symptoms include a rough engine idle‚ poor acceleration‚ and reduced overall performance. Ignoring this code can lead to increased emissions and potential damage to the catalytic converter. Consulting a codes list PDF provides detailed guidance for diagnosing and resolving this issue effectively.

P0304 ー Cylinder 4 Misfire Detected

The P0304 code indicates a misfire in cylinder 4‚ which can be caused by a faulty spark plug‚ ignition coil‚ or fuel injector. A vacuum leak or low fuel pressure may also trigger this code. Symptoms include a rough engine idle‚ poor performance‚ and a decrease in fuel efficiency. Ignoring this issue can lead to more severe damage‚ such as catalytic converter failure. Consulting a codes list PDF or repair manual is essential for accurate diagnosis and repairs‚ ensuring the issue is resolved promptly to prevent further complications.

P0401 ⎼ Exhaust Gas Recirculation (EGR) Flow Insufficient

The P0401 code signifies a problem with the Exhaust Gas Recirculation (EGR) system‚ specifically insufficient flow. This can occur due to a clogged EGR valve‚ blocked EGR cooler‚ or faulty vacuum hoses. Symptoms may include rough engine idle‚ decreased performance‚ and increased emissions. Addressing this issue promptly is crucial‚ as prolonged neglect can lead to engine damage or emissions test failures. Referencing a codes list PDF or repair manual is recommended for precise diagnosis and repair steps‚ ensuring the EGR system functions correctly to maintain engine efficiency and reduce emissions.

P0442 ⎼ Evaporative Emission Control (EVAP) System Small Leak

The P0442 code indicates a small leak in the Evaporative Emission Control (EVAP) system. Common causes include a loose or damaged gas cap‚ cracked fuel lines‚ or faulty connectors. This leak allows fuel vapors to escape‚ which can lead to decreased fuel efficiency and emissions issues. A codes list PDF can guide diagnostics‚ suggesting a visual inspection of components and pressure tests. Addressing the issue promptly prevents further damage and ensures compliance with emissions standards‚ maintaining the vehicle’s performance and environmental efficiency.

Differences Between Generic and Specific Codes

Generic codes‚ such as P0300‚ are universal OBD-II codes applicable to all vehicles. Manufacturer-specific codes‚ like those starting with “P1xxx‚” are unique to brands like Dodge. While generic codes indicate common issues‚ specific codes provide detailed‚ brand-exclusive diagnostics. For the Dodge Ram 1500‚ a codes list PDF often includes both types‚ helping technicians identify whether the issue is widespread or specific to Chrysler Group vehicles. This distinction is crucial for precise repairs and ensures accurate troubleshooting.

How to Identify Manufacturer-Specific Codes

Manufacturer-specific codes for the Dodge Ram 1500 begin with “P1” and are unique to Chrysler Group vehicles. These codes are distinct from generic OBD-II codes and provide detailed diagnostics tailored to specific systems. For example‚ codes like P1XXX are exclusive to Dodge and require a codes list PDF or official repair manual for accurate interpretation. These codes often relate to proprietary systems‚ such as Chrysler’s engine or transmission controls‚ ensuring precise troubleshooting for issues unique to the vehicle’s design;

4.1 Origin in the Mahabharata

The Vishnu Sahasranamam originates from the Mahabharata, specifically during the Kurukshetra war. It is a divine dialogue where the wounded Bheeshma recites the 1,000 names of Lord Vishnu to Yudhishthira, highlighting Vishnu’s universal supremacy and benevolence. This sacred chant embodies profound philosophical truths and is considered a cornerstone of Hindu spirituality. Its recitation is believed to bring spiritual enlightenment, peace, and divine blessings, making it a timeless hymn revered across generations for its deeper meaning and connection to the divine.

4.2 Bheeshma’s Role in the Composition

Bheeshma, a revered warrior and sage, played a pivotal role in the composition of the Vishnu Sahasranamam. During the Kurukshetra war, as he lay on his bed of arrows, he recited the 1,000 names of Lord Vishnu to Yudhishthira. This act of devotion and wisdom showcased Bheeshma’s deep understanding of Vishnu’s divine attributes and his role as the preserver of the universe. His recitation emphasized the significance of devotion, moral integrity, and the pursuit of dharma. Bheeshma’s contribution underscores the hymn’s spiritual depth and its enduring relevance in Hindu philosophy and worship.

1.1 Overview of the Push-Pull-Legs Split

The Push-Pull-Legs (PPL) split is a popular training method dividing workouts into three categories: push days (chest, shoulders, triceps), pull days (back, biceps, core), and leg days (quadriceps, hamstrings, glutes). This structure allows for balanced muscle development and recovery. Typically, it can be adapted into 3-, 4-, or 6-day routines, with rest days incorporated for recovery. The split promotes hypertrophy and strength by targeting each muscle group twice weekly, making it highly customizable for various fitness goals and levels.

Sample 3-Day Push-Pull-Legs Workout Routine

This 3-day plan divides workouts into push, pull, and legs days, targeting specific muscle groups. It’s designed for balanced growth and efficiency, suitable for all fitness levels.

4.1 Day 1: Push Day Exercises and Sets

Push Day focuses on chest, shoulders, and triceps. Typical exercises include:

  • Paused Bench Press: 4 sets of 8-12 reps
  • Inclined Dumbbell Press: 3 sets of 10-15 reps
  • Shoulder Press: 4 sets of 8-12 reps
  • Cable Lateral Raises: 3 sets of 12-15 reps
  • Push-Ups: 3 sets of 10-15 reps
  • Lying Dumbbell Tricep Extensions: 4 sets of 10-12 reps

Rest for 1-3 minutes between sets to maximize hypertrophy and strength gains.

4.2 Day 2: Pull Day Exercises and Sets

Pull Day targets back, biceps, and core muscles. Key exercises include:

  • Lat Pulldown: 4 sets of 8-12 reps
  • Cable Seated Row: 4 sets of 8-10 reps
  • Deadlift: 3 sets of 6-8 reps
  • Pull-Ups: 3 sets of 8-12 reps
  • Cable Face Pull: 3 sets of 10-15 reps
  • Barbell Curl: 4 sets of 8-12 reps
  • Russian Twists: 3 sets of 15-20 reps

Rest for 1-3 minutes between sets to optimize strength and hypertrophy.

4.3 Day 3: Legs Day Exercises and Sets

Legs Day focuses on building quadriceps, hamstrings, glutes, and core. Key exercises include:

  • Squats: 4 sets of 6-8 reps
  • Leg Press: 4 sets of 8-10 reps
  • Romanian Deadlift: 3 sets of 8-10 reps
  • Walking Lunges: 3 sets of 10-12 reps
  • Leg Curls: 4 sets of 10-12 reps
  • Calf Raises: 4 sets of 12-15 reps
  • Plank: 3 sets of 30-60 seconds

Rest for 1-3 minutes between sets to maximize muscle growth and endurance.

National Pipe Taper (NPT) Threads

National Pipe Taper (NPT) threads are a standard for tapered pipe connections in the USA. They have a 1/16″ taper per inch and a 60-degree thread angle, ensuring a tight seal in piping systems. Widely adopted in industrial and plumbing applications, NPT threads are specified under the ANSI B1.20.1 standard, making them a reliable choice for secure connections.

2.1 Definition and Characteristics of NPT Threads

NPT (National Pipe Taper) threads are a standardized tapered screw thread used for connecting pipes and fittings. They have a 1.7899-degree taper angle and a 60-degree thread angle, ensuring a tight, leak-free seal when properly engaged. NPT threads are commonly used in North America and are defined under the ANSI B1.20.1 standard. Their tapered design requires the use of sealant compounds to ensure thread integrity and prevent leakage.

2.2 Taper Rate and Thread Angle in NPT

NPT threads feature a taper rate of 1:16, meaning the diameter increases by 1 inch over 16 inches of length. The thread angle is 60 degrees, with a taper angle of 1;7899 degrees. This design ensures a tight, leak-free connection when threads engage. The combination of taper and angle provides self-sealing properties, enhanced by the use of sealant compounds. These specifications are standardized under ANSI B1.20.1, ensuring consistency across applications.

Basic Dimensions of NPT Threads

Major diameter refers to the thread’s outer dimension, while the minor diameter is the inner portion. These measurements ensure proper fit and sealing in piping connections. Key dimensions like 1.05 inches for a 3/4 NPT highlight the precision required for compatibility and mechanical strength.

3.1 Major and Minor Diameters

The major diameter is the largest diameter of the thread, while the minor diameter is the smallest, at the base of the thread. These measurements are critical for ensuring proper fit and sealing. For example, a 1/4 NPT thread has a major diameter of 0.54 inches and a minor diameter of 0.26 inches. These dimensions are standardized to ensure compatibility and mechanical strength in piping systems.

  • Major diameter: Defines the thread’s outer dimension.
  • Minor diameter: Specifies the thread’s inner portion.

3.2 Pitch and Threads Per Inch (TPI)

The pitch is the distance between corresponding points on adjacent threads, while Threads Per Inch (TPI) measures the number of threads within a one-inch span. For example, a 3/4 NPT thread has a pitch of 0.0714 inches and 14 TPI. These measurements ensure proper thread engagement and sealing. Accurate pitch and TPI are vital for compatibility and mechanical integrity in piping systems.

  • Pitch: Distance between thread peaks.
  • TPI: Number of threads in one inch.

4.1 Measuring Outside Diameter (OD)

Measuring the outside diameter (OD) is essential for identifying NPT pipe thread sizes. Using a caliper, measure the diameter across the pipe’s outer threads. This measurement helps determine the nominal pipe size by comparing it to standard charts. For example, a 3/4 NPT thread has an OD of 1.050 inches. Accurate OD measurement ensures proper thread identification and compatibility, preventing fitting issues. This step is critical for maintaining system integrity and preventing leaks or mechanical failures in piping connections.

4.2 Using Thread Charts for Identification

Thread charts are invaluable for identifying NPT pipe thread sizes. These charts list outside diameter (OD) and threads per inch (TPI) for each nominal size. By comparing measured dimensions to the chart, accurate identification is ensured. For instance, a 3/4 NPT thread has an OD of 1.050 inches and 14 TPI. Using these charts prevents sizing errors, ensuring compatibility and proper connections in piping systems. They are a key resource for maintaining consistency and avoiding installation issues.

NPT Pipe Thread Size Chart

The chart lists NPT sizes, including 1/16″ to 4″ nominal pipe sizes. Each size specifies outside diameter (OD) and threads per inch (TPI), ensuring precise connections and compatibility. For example, 1/4″ NPT has an OD of 0.54″ and 18 TPI. This standardized chart is essential for identifying and selecting the correct NPT threads for various applications, ensuring leak-free and secure pipe connections in industrial systems.

5.1 Common NPT Sizes and Specifications

Common NPT sizes range from 1/16″ to 4″ nominal pipe sizes. Each size specifies the outside diameter (OD) and threads per inch (TPI), ensuring compatibility. For example, a 1/4″ NPT has an OD of 0.54″ and 18 TPI, while a 1/2″ NPT has an OD of 0.84″ and 14 TPI. These standardized measurements ensure secure, leak-free connections in piping systems, making NPT threads a reliable choice for industrial applications. Proper sizing is critical for maintaining system integrity and performance.

5.2 Nominal Pipe Size (NPS) vs. Actual Diameter

Nominal Pipe Size (NPS) is a designation, not the actual measured diameter. It often differs from the actual outside diameter (OD). For example, a 1/2″ NPS pipe has an OD of 0.84″, while its nominal size is 0.5″. This distinction is crucial for ordering and fitting pipes, as actual dimensions must match specifications to ensure proper connections and avoid fitting issues. Always refer to NPT charts for precise measurements.

Understanding Intrinsic vs. Extrinsic Motivation

Intrinsic motivation stems from internal drivers like personal satisfaction or enjoyment, while extrinsic motivation is fueled by external rewards, such as money or recognition. Intrinsic motivation often leads to more sustainable success, as it aligns with personal values and passions. Extrinsic rewards can boost short-term performance but may diminish intrinsic drive over time, a phenomenon known as the overjustification effect. Balancing both types can optimize achievement and fulfillment.
